MySQL中的集合变量的使用(mysql集合变量)

MySQL是世界上最流行的关系数据库系统,它具有强大的查询功能和使用方便。它提供多种用于数据存储和管理的功能,并支持多种数据类型,其中包括集合变量。

在MySQL中,集合变量包括SET,ENUM和BIT。 MySQL中的集合类型可以用来存储最多65,535个唯一值,值以逗号分隔,每个值的最大长度为64个字符。集合类型可以大幅简化数据量并提高查询性能,以便在MySQL中更有效地存储数据。

要使用 My SQL中的集合变量,首先要在您的MySQL数据表中定义集合类型的字段。 例如,如果要使用 ENUM 类型字段来存储性别列表,可以通过以下语法定义 ENUM 类型的字段:

CREATE TABLE users(
Name VARCHAR(50),
Gender ENUM('male', 'female', 'other')
);

该语句定义了一个新的表 users,其中包含两个字段:Name(字符)和Gender(枚举类型),只能从male,female和other值中选择。

要将数据添加到表中,可以使用以下 INSERT 语句:

INSERT INTO users(Name, Gender)
VALUES('John', 'male');

以上是将数据添加到表中的一种方法。

此外,您还可以使用 UPDATE 语句从表中更新数据:

UPDATE users
SET Gender = 'other'
WHERE Name = 'John';

使用MySQL数据库时,如果需要存储有限个数值的列表,可以使用集合变量,可以大大简化数据量,提高查询性能,而且可以节省存储空间。


数据运维技术 » MySQL中的集合变量的使用(mysql集合变量)